Health workers urge GMCH not to make them unemployeds

Aurangabad, July 15:

The contractual health staff appointed by the Government Medical College and Hospital (GMCH) administration for a temporary period, during the second wave of Covid-19, has requested not to make them unemployed and re-instate in their jobs.

The GMCH administration had a meeting with the delegation of these Covid Warriors today. However, the GMCH administration has clarified to them that further recruitment in the future will be made through the private agency only. The GMCH has also instructed the contractor to prepare the list of health staff as per the seniority, in two days.

GMCH's Dean Dr. Kanan Yelikar, deputy dean Dr. Kailas Zhine, Dr. Bharat Sonawane, and medical superintendent Dr. Suresh Harbade were present in the meeting. Meanwhile, AITUC has threatened of intensifying the agitation, if the GMCH administration does not take the health staff on duty by Sunday.

Adv Abhay Taksal, Vikas Gaikwad, Gajanan Khandare, Kiran Pandit, Amol Sarode, Ratan Ambilwade, Abhijeet Bansode, Nanda Hiwrale, Neeta Bhalerao, and other health staff were also present in the meeting.
